Technical Specifications

  • Main Chip: ESP32S (WiFi + Bluetooth + BLE MCU)
  • USB-to-Serial: CP2102
  • Pin Count: 30 Pins
  • PCB Dimensions: ~70 × 60 mm / 2.75 × 2.36 in
  • GPIO Configuration: 1-into-2 breakout expansion
  • Wireless: WiFi 802.11 b/g/n, Bluetooth Classic & BLE
  • Compatible Frameworks: Arduino IDE, MicroPython, Lua (NodeMCU), ESP-IDF
  • Color Options: 3 available

Q: What programming languages and frameworks are supported by the CP2102 NodeMCU-32S board?

A: This board is compatible with a wide range of development environments, including the Arduino IDE (C/C++), MicroPython, Lua scripting via the NodeMCU firmware, and Espressif's own ESP-IDF framework. The CP2102 chip ensures stable USB serial communication for easy code uploads from your computer.
